Ripka advance purchase watch

I tried blowing up the picture and noticed this watch has a Japanese movement and is made in China. The other watches I ve had from her are made in Thailand with Swiss part movements. Not sure what to think about that.... I like that it is listed as slightly smaller face at 1.25 in vs the normal 1.5. I am curious if any of you own the original if it has the same movement as this new release?? Just curious because I do like it. Tia

Other watch manufacturers have turned to Japanese movements. Look at Coach watches by Movado. They used to be Swiss Made!

Some of JR's watches had Swiss Movements and 5ATM water resistance. Then they had Swiss Parts movements. Her cheaper watches have had Japanese movements. All were very attractive.

There is a range of quality of watch movements from every manufacturer and every source. So without knowing the specific movement, there is no way to know what it's quality is. However, I collect watches, and consider Japanese movements to be equal quality or better than Swiss Parts movements.
